Transaction 23bdf90671956ebce26c8dbb66c2c454029f8ae641ffa9a50a9ecbc148eb4715

1 Input
2 Outputs
  • 23bdf90671956ebce26c8dbb66c2c454029f8ae641ffa9a50a9ecbc148eb4715:0
  • value  981489
    address  39uWzSuB7mwtMqwNpJ7fihijmcUP9skAWi
  • 23bdf90671956ebce26c8dbb66c2c454029f8ae641ffa9a50a9ecbc148eb4715:1
  • value  14170780
    address  3HXDVE5uUbLiafMmE2L9kNUrMX3Q4hjYcL